Spain | Public-sector deficit, 2,2% of GDP in May
Summary
Public-sector deficit (excluding local corporations) stood at 2.2% of GDP in May, marginally improving the level obtained in 2015 and showing that its in an inconsistent track to reduce the imbalance in the public administration's aggregate to a number lower than 4% of GDP by the end of 2016.
